High incidence of the CFTR mutations 3272-26A -> G and L927P in Belgian cystic fibrosis patients, and identification of three new CFTR mutations (l86-2A -> G, E588V, and 1671insTATCA)

open access: yes, 2007
Abstract: We have analyzed 143 unrelated Belgian patients with a positive diagnosis of cystic fibrosis (CF) for mutations in the cystic fibrosis transmembrane conductance regular:or (CFTR) gene. An initial screening for 29 CFTR mutations led to mutation identification in 89.9% of the tested chromosomes.
